runescape television is a film and research studio producing video essays, narrative films and documentaries; info, store


     

            The Longer You Bleed, 2024.



                                          

                                                         Jellyfish, 2024.



                    

                                       SPIEGEL, 2022



             

                                   Liminal Suburbia, 2021




                                          velodrama, 2022




                         LOST IN TRANSLATION, (SBYaS), 2022


   

                   Drinking Water, 2022



                

                                                 WEEZ, 2021






                          THE CHAIR, 2022



               

                                                      The Doorknob, 2022


                

                                                           Fragmented Youth, 2019




        BEIDE SEITEN DES GLASES, 2021

 

      

                       intestine, 2019









                           


                               Social Media is Ruining Our Lives, 2018









        

               vertigo, 2018









                                                     

                                                     Fuji Glass, 2018